Lilitus is a common lily, its name comes from the words lily and lotus, warning, the following ones have Cañangas ñangas inspirations, I will only say that the last one is inspired by La Llorona

Drownily is the product of a large amount of nutrients in the pokemon, which naturally can only be achieved in one way, using the dead body of some creature as fuel, and not just any, but drowned children in the river, so this is not usually found commonly in nature, its name comes from the words drowned and lotus in English, lloralpae is more common to see, it is the product of an even greater amount of nutrients, it has acquired a sense of motherhood for all making it a very kind pokemon even with its terrifying appearance, the same sense of motherhood makes it make sounds similar to crying to scare the childrens and prevent them from playing near the river, and do not cause the evolution of another lilitus, this is inspired by la llorona and a swamp monster, its name comes from crying ''llorar'' in Spanish from la llorona, and algae
